This is a lovely Silver ingot pendant, it’s unusual because the hallmarks are stamped sideways which I haven’t seen on another ingot before, so if your buying to add to or start a collection than this maybe a great one as it’s more a harder piece to find. This one was made to celebrate Queen Elizabeth II silver jubilee in 1977 and therefore have the stamp depicting the Queen. I love how ingots have their hallmarks front and centre they are such a gorgeous part of every piece of jewellery so it’s lovely to celebrate that.
Hallmarks- MPME maker, C= 1977, Lion for sterling, Birmingham assay, Queen
Weighs- 30.33g
Measures- 5cm x 1.8cm
This ingot is in great condition, as with anything vintage there maybe signs of wear. It has been cleaned and polished.
